Launching vr onboarding for remote teams in 30 days is ambitious but achievable with a disciplined project plan. In our experience, success depends on three foundations up front: reliable connectivity, clear IT and security policies, and a streamlined procurement process that keeps logistics predictable. This guide walks HR and IT leaders through every operational step—hardware, content, pilot, feedback, scale—so you can deliver a secure, engaging virtual onboarding experience remote hires will actually use.

Prerequisites: connectivity, IT policy, procurement

Start by validating the basics. Remote deployments fail when teams treat headsets like software only. Confirm home-office network minimums (recommended: 25 Mbps down, 5 Mbps up, low latency), and map where employees fall short. Build an exceptions workflow for locations with limited broadband.

Define IT policies before procurement: device enrollment, acceptable-use, data retention, and return logistics. Secure approval for VPN/MDM integration and a whitelist for content delivery domains. Procurement should select two headset models (primary and fallback) to avoid single-vendor delays.

  • Connectivity checklist: bandwidth test, firewall rules, VPN compatibility
  • Policy checklist: device ownership, wipe/remote reset, sanitization rules
  • Procurement: PO templates, lead times, spare units (10% buffer)

30-Day Plan: week-by-week milestones

Break the month into four weekly sprints with clear deliverables. Each week contains operational and learning milestones so HR and IT can coordinate timing and expectations.

We recommend this cadence to deploy vr onboarding for remote teams efficiently while preserving quality:

Week 1 — Hardware sourcing & baseline setup

Confirm vendor quotes and place orders with staggered deliveries. Configure baseline images and MDM profiles for headset provisioning. Create asset tags and shipping templates.

Week 2 — Content prep & pilot cohort selection

Finalize core modules: company mission, role-specific simulations, compliance micro-lessons. Convert existing onboarding slides into VR-friendly scenes. Identify a pilot cohort of 10-20 new hires or internal volunteers across regions.

Week 3 — Pilot deployment and feedback loop

Ship headsets to the pilot cohort with clear return and sanitization instructions. Run live support sessions during their first VR session. Collect structured feedback via surveys and a moderated focus group.

Week 4 — Iterate and scale

Incorporate pilot feedback, update content and support scripts, and begin ramping shipments to the broader rollout. Lock down SLA response times and support staffing for scale.

  1. Deliverable each week: checklist completed and signoff from HR and IT
  2. Decision point: go/no-go after pilot based on usability and safety metrics

Logistics: shipping, sanitizing, and asset tracking

Operational logistics win or lose the rollout. Develop a shipping playbook with packaging, insurance, and tracking. Use parcel services that integrate with your asset database so serial numbers and UPS/FedEx tracking map to employee IDs automatically.

Sanitization is critical for health and trust. Provide each kit with disposable face covers, alcohol wipes, and a step-by-step cleaning card. Define a quarantine and inspection process for returned units before reprovisioning.

ItemActionNotes
HeadsetAsset tag, MDM enroll, shipKeep 10% spare
ControllersPair, intake checklistReplace damaged units within SLA
Sanitization kitInclude in each outbound packageDisposable face pads recommended
Operational detail like asset tracking and sanitization policies reduce device downtime and build employee trust faster than flashy content alone.

Remote support and device management

Remote teams need hands-on help in VR rollouts. Implement an MDM that supports headsets for remote wipe, app pushes, and telemetry. Train a 1st-line support team with a tech script and escalation matrix.

Provide multiple support channels: scheduled live sessions, same-day chat, and an emergency hotline. Track support metrics to meet SLAs and adjust staffing during peak onboarding windows.

How do you manage updates and security?

Automate updates through staged releases: alpha for IT, beta for pilot, general for production. Use signed builds and a content delivery network (CDN) to reduce latency. Log and audit access to sensitive VR modules to meet compliance requirements.

  • MDM tasks: enroll, remote wipe, push apps
  • Support tasks: first-touch troubleshooting, escalation to IT

Communications plan for HR / People Ops

A clear communication plan reduces confusion and ensures adoption. Prepare email templates, calendar invites, and a short explainer video showing headset setup in a home office. Use the headset photos and timeline visuals to set expectations.

Segment communications by role and region. Include a pre-arrival checklist for each new hire, the shipment tracking link, and a short pre-brief to cover safety and ergonomics. Provide FAQs that answer common questions about privacy, data collection, and accessibility.

What should HR say in first outreach?

Sample subject line: “Your VR Onboarding Kit — Shipping Info & First Session.” In the body, give action steps: confirm address, complete bandwidth test, and book a 30-minute orientation slot. Attach a one-page setup card with images for home-office headset placement.

  1. Pre-shipment: confirmation + bandwidth test
  2. Shipment: tracking + checklist
  3. Session day: orientation link + live support contact

Troubleshooting, backup plans, sample SLAs and training scripts

Prepare a tiered troubleshooting playbook. Tier 1 covers connectivity and account issues resolved within 4 business hours. Tier 2 involves hardware faults and requires replacement within 48 hours. Tier 3 escalates to vendor RMA with clear timelines.

Include a backup plan: if a headset fails or bandwidth is insufficient, provide a synchronous video-based orientation and schedule a replacement device. Keep a pool of regional spare units for rapid dispatch.

Sample SLA: Tier 1 response within 4 hours; Tier 2 replacement within 48 hours; Tier 3 vendor RMA within 7 days.

Use concise scripts for support interactions. Example first-touch script: greet, confirm employee identity and device serial, run bandwidth test, check MDM enrollment, and schedule replacement if needed. Keep scripts in a shared knowledge base and update after each pilot iteration.

Sample training script (first VR session)

“Welcome — today’s 30-minute session covers company mission, your role simulation, and where to find resources. Put on your headset, follow the orientation scene, and use the hand controllers to interact. If you need help, press the support button on the main menu or call the support line.”

Conclusion: key takeaways and next steps

Rolling out vr onboarding for remote teams in 30 days requires disciplined prerequisites, a tight week-by-week plan, and operational excellence in logistics and support. Prioritize connectivity validation, MDM setup, and a pilot that informs rapid iteration. Secure buy-in from HR, IT, and procurement early to avoid late delays.

Metrics to track in the first 90 days: completion rate, session satisfaction, device failure rate, and time-to-resolution for support tickets. A pattern we've noticed is that organizations that treat logistics and support as part of the learning design see much higher adoption.

Next step: run a 10-person pilot using the week-by-week plan above, capture quantitative and qualitative feedback, and use the provided scripts and SLA templates to standardize operations before scaling.
